NABUCHODONOSOR
nab-u-ko-don'-o-sor (Nabouchodonosor): Septuagint and Vulgate (Jerome's Latin Bible, 390-405 A.D.) form of "Nebuchadnezzar" ("Nebuchadrezzar") found in the King James Version of the Apocrypha in 1 Esdras 1:40,41,45,48; 2:10; 5:7; 6:26; Additions to Esther 11:4; Baruch 1:9,11,12. It is the form used in the King James Version of the Apocrypha throughout. In the Revised Version (British and American) of Judith and Tobit 14:15, the form "Nebuchadnezzar" is given.
